09:41 — The Quayside load balancer began marking healthy Fernlock API nodes as failed. Investigation showed the health-check endpoint was pinned to a deprecated port after the Bramwell config rollout, so probes timed out while real traffic succeeded. New team members should note probes and traffic can diverge. The offending deploy's token is recorded below.

session token of tajef-bageg = htk21_5d90d574934f3ccae6437

Ticket: SQL linter going rogue on Harlowe Depot migration files. Support team, if customers report "unexpected keyword" errors when saving .sql files in the Depot editor, it's our new lint ruleset being overly strict about vendor-specific syntax. The rules flag perfectly valid window functions as errors. Workaround for now: tell them to disable rule group `strict-ansi` in their project settings. Fix is queued for the next patch. When escalating, include the trace token from their failed lint run right below this note.

session token of fahap-hawip = htk31_7852f2b3276dba2738f98fa97f92237

Handover Note — From G. Marchetti to L. Fennimore

Quick rundown on the big-deal discount policy: anything over the Tier 3 threshold now needs my sign-off (soon yours), and stacked discounts above 20% are off the table. Sales leads know the drill, but a few will test you early. Hold firm. The margin targets driving this policy are in the confidential note below.

management briefing: Project Gorir slips by two quarters because of the tooling delay.